MARCON, ELDERLY GUESTS OF THE RSA SERENI ORIZZONTI JOIN THE CARITAS INITIATIVE AND PREPARE HANDICRAFTS FOR THE COLLECTION OF BASIC GOODS

The elderly guests of the RSA 'San Giorgio' in Marcon joined the initiative of Caritas Interparrocchiale di Marcon in preparing shortbread biscuits in the shape of carnival masks, unique pieces, produced and packaged by our cookery workshop to raise funds for the purchase of primary goods.

The guests, made aware of the social importance of the project, dusted off some special recipes, trying to make the desserts they made inviting, special and above all delicious.

"The guests of the facilities are the centre of attention and care of the staff caring for them," says Danjiela Filkovska, the facility's director. "Unlike usual, this activity allowed them to feel useful for someone else. This had a very beneficial effect on the guests: in addition to manual reactivation, there was an interest and care that went beyond mere accomplishment".

It is precisely on the occasion of Carnival that Caritas Interparrocchiale di Marcon has realised this initiative: the preparation of shortbread biscuits in the shape of masks, to be distributed as a snack. The cost of each individual biscuit will be very small, but it will still be useful to collect an adequate amount of money to replenish the stocks intended for the most needy.
